Technology Gartner says sub-$500 entry level PCs could disappear by 2028 as memory prices surge Syndication March 2, 2026 Writing in a press statement, Gartner warns that soaring memory costs are projected to cause a 10.4% worldwide decline in PC shipments while smartphone shipments are expected to drop by 8.4% in 2026.
